Bring the latest technology to bear in the fight for sustainable agriculture with this timely volume Artificial intelligence (AI) has the potential to revolutionize virtually every area of research and scientific practice, including agriculture. With AI solutions emerging to drive higher yields, produce increased resource efficiency, and foster sustainability, there is an urgent need for a volume outlining this progress and charting its future course. Emerging Smart Agricultural Practices Using Artificial Intelligence meets this need with a deep dive into the rapidly developing intersection of agriculture and artificial intelligence. Taking an interdisciplinary approach which applies data science, computer science, and engineering techniques, the book provides cutting-edge insights on the latest advancements in AI-driven agricultural practices. The result is an absolutely critical tool in the ongoing fight to develop sustainable world agriculture.
